Understanding Walgreens Prescription Discount Programs

Walgreens provides several discount options to help customers save on prescriptions. These include the Walgreens Prescription Savings Club, manufacturer copay cards, and store discounts. Familiarizing yourself with these programs can help you choose the best savings method for your needs.

Enroll in the Walgreens Prescription Savings Club

The Walgreens Prescription Savings Club offers members discounts on thousands of medications. Membership is available for a small annual fee and provides significant savings, especially for those without insurance or with high copays.

To enroll, visit your local Walgreens store or sign up online through the Walgreens website. Once enrolled, present your membership card at checkout to receive discounts.

Utilize Manufacturer Copay Cards and Assistance Programs

Many pharmaceutical companies offer copay cards and assistance programs that can reduce out-of-pocket costs. These are especially useful for expensive medications or drugs not covered by insurance.

Check with your healthcare provider or pharmacist to see if your medication qualifies for a manufacturer discount. Always read the terms and conditions to understand eligibility and usage limits.

Compare Prices and Use Digital Tools

Before filling a prescription, use Walgreens’ online tools or mobile app to compare prices. The Walgreens app allows you to view medication costs at different stores and select the most affordable option.

Additionally, some third-party websites and apps can help compare pharmacy prices nationwide, helping you find the best deal for your medication.

Plan Your Prescriptions and Bulk Purchases

Planning your prescriptions can lead to savings. Request longer prescriptions (such as 90-day supplies) when possible, as they often come with discounts and reduce the number of trips to the pharmacy.

Some medications may be available in generic versions, which are typically less expensive. Ask your healthcare provider if switching to a generic is appropriate for your treatment.

Stay Informed About Special Promotions

Walgreens frequently runs promotions and special discounts on select medications. Sign up for their email alerts or follow their social media channels to stay informed about these deals.

Timing your purchases during sales events can lead to substantial savings, especially for non-urgent medications.
